    Legal basis: Regulations on the Service of Soldiers on Active Duty of the Chinese People's Liberation Army Article 42 A soldier who meets one of the following conditions shall be discharged from active service:

    1) Those who have not been selected as non-commissioned officers at the end of their active service;

    2) Non-commissioned officers who have completed the maximum number of years of active service at the same level and have not been selected as a non-commissioned officer of the next higher level, and who are unable to continue to serve on active duty during the period of active service at the same level due to restrictions on the number of posts;

    3) Those who have served on active duty for 30 years and need to retire from active duty or who have reached the age of 55;

    4) Unable to continue to work normally after being assessed for disability due to war, duty, or illness;

    5) Upon completion of the period of medical treatment for illness or the end of medical treatment, the applicant is unfit to continue active service upon certification from a military hospital or upon review and confirmation by the health department of a unit at or above the military level;

    6) Those who need to withdraw from active duty due to the adjustment of the military establishment;

    7) Retired from active service due to the need for national construction;

    8) Members of a soldier's family who have suffered a major illness or major disaster or other changes that truly need to maintain the normal life of the family themselves, and have been certified by the competent department for the resettlement of retired soldiers at the county level where the soldier's family is located, and have been approved by the commander of a unit at or above the division (brigade) level to retire from active service;

    9) Those who are not suitable to continue to serve on active duty for other reasons, and who are retired from active duty with the approval of the commander organ of a unit at or above the division (brigade) level.

    1. Pull-ups. Pull-ups are the basic contact method, but pay attention to the intensity and number of exercises, don't be greedy, every 1 2 times, pay attention to rest, otherwise it is easy to strain muscles. Generally, 6 to 10 times is appropriate.

    2. Move on the ladder to do the transfer on the ladder, each time the hand moves forward a horizontal bar, and the two hands alternately travel. This action is a very test of arm strength of the exercise method, requiring the exercise of the person to have a very strong arm, after doing a few to take a proper rest, massage the arm, so as not to muscle soreness and strain.

    3. Hanging posture. The practitioner of arm suspension first stands on the stool, holds the bar with both arms fully bent, hands shoulder-width apart, so that the bar is under the chin, and then leaves the feet from the bench to make a static and forceful hanging position, but the chin must not be hung on the bar. This movement is more difficult, testing not only the strength of the practitioner's arms, wrists, but also endurance.

    During the process, the breathing should be adjusted evenly, and if you can't hold on, stop in time to avoid contusion.

    4. Oblique pull-ups. Hold the bar with both hands shoulder-width apart, stretch out your feet forward to push the ground, so that the arms and torso are hanging diagonally at 90°, and the companion holds down the feet and does a pull-up with the bent arms, so that the chin touches or exceeds the horizontal bar, and then the arms are extended and restored once. This action has the element of mutual cooperation, which requires tacit cooperation with the partner, moderate rest, and greater contact intensity.

    5. Supine hanging arm flexion and extension, the student does a supine hanging position on the low horizontal bar, and the partner holds his ankle or calf, and raises the practitioner's foot to the horizontal position. This action has higher requirements for the collaborator and is also more testing of strength. Drink plenty of water during your exercises. to avoid dehydration.

    6. Use both hands and feet or only use the hand to climb the pole or rope according to personal strength, climb 5 6 meters each time, and practice 3 4 times.
